The US oil giant has signed a non-binding deal with New Standard Energy, looking to spend up to $A103 million in Western Australia. The aim is to finalise the agreement by September 2011, and begin the Goldwyer project by 2012.

The Goldwyer project runs along the northern edge of Great Sandy Desert and stretches across 45,000 sq km of the onshore Canning Basin.

This follows the uncovering of South Australia’s shale gas potential by Adelaide-based Beach Energy. Although just beginning to gain momentum in Australia, the shale gas industry already accounts for 23 per cent of US gas production.
